Hey is it normal for the fuel pressure to bleed down after a few hours have passed?
after a few hours have passed yea it will bleed down a little bit. is it at zero completely? can you specify how long?

my check valve went bad in my Fuel pump and the fuel pressure would bleed down to zero in about a minute after turning off the motor.
